  • How to make FFmpeg download only the required segments [closed]

    25 juillet, par daniil_

    I'm developing a tool, that create timelapse. For this purpose I use ffmpeg 7.1.1 verion.
I have a playlist file called index.m3u8 (inside it there are URLs to TS segments—typically around 5,000 of them). Here’s a small excerpt :

    I’m trying to extract still images from the stream at specific moments.

    


    When I run a command like :

    


    ffmpeg \
  -analyzeduration 5000000 \
  -probesize 5000000 \
  -err_detect ignore_err \
  -protocol_whitelist file,http,https,tcp,tls \
  -allowed_extensions ALL \
  -f hls \
  -y \
  -ss 11316.719 \
  -i /Users/daniil/Desktop/test/exports/.../index.m3u8 \
  -frames:v 1 \
  -q:v 2 \
  /Users/daniil/Desktop/test/exports/.../frames/frame_00100.png


    


    ffmpeg downloads segments 1 and 2 (presumably to probe the format), and then it downloads two more TS files around the target timestamp.

    


    But as soon as I push the -ss value beyond a certain point—in my case -ss 8487.54—it starts downloading every TS segment from the very start of the playlist up to the one I need. That can easily be 1,000 TS files or more. In other words, when -ss is between 0 and 8374.372, everything works fine, but beyond that it exhibits this strange behavior.

    


  • specifying output format in ffmpeg

    19 janvier 2013, par JPM

    Writing an audio/video application in C++ and using ffmpeg library to handle file i/o.

    I want the output video to be written as uncompressed. How does one specify the output parameters : codec, file wrapper, frame rate, etc. to ffmpeg ?

    What i have found is av_guess_format which clues off of the output filename extension specified.

    can someone point me to the .h file with the legal extensions ?
    how would I specify the frame rate ? is there a function call or does one just fiddle the entries in the AVOutputFormat structure ?

    Has anyone found a reasonable tutorial or document for ffmpeg ?
